Energy thieves: The 7 biggest offenders when it comes to wasting energy in your home

Topics: Energy Smart
energythieves

When you think about the major energy users in your home, the refrigerator, washer, dryer and dishwasher come to mind. But while those items use a lot of energy, that energy is usually being put to good use. The true energy thieves are those appliances that are draining electricity from the outlets even when they aren’t necessarily in use.
